Unlock Your Creative Potential: Succeeding with Amazon Merch

Gray clothing tag on white fabric, related to Amazon Merch success guide.

Unleashing Creativity with Amazon Merch

If you've ever dreamed of turning your creative designs into a profitable enterprise, Amazon Merch could be your gateway. The platform empowers creators to upload artwork and sell it on various products without the burdens of inventory management or shipping concerns. Imagine millions of potential customers browsing Amazon daily — the opportunity to reach a vast audience is right at your fingertips!

Simplified Print-on-Demand Solution

Amazon Merch simplifies the complexities of print-on-demand. As a creator, your main focus is crafting eye-catching designs while Amazon handles the production and shipping logistics. This operational aspect allows you to channel your energy into creating unique products that resonate with consumers. Whether you're a seasoned designer or just starting, there's a place for you in this vibrant marketplace.

Low Financial Risk Equals High Reward

One of the standout features of Amazon Merch is its low financial risk for entrepreneurs. With no upfront production costs, budding creators can launch their online business with minimal investment. This model is perfect for individuals with limited startup capital, allowing them to explore their creative passions without the fear of hefty financial losses.

The Importance of Unique Designs

In the competitive world of Amazon Merch, standing out is non-negotiable. It's imperative to emphasize originality in your product designs. Not only does this attract customers, but adhering to copyright guidelines is crucial in protecting your work from potential legal issues. By monitoring trends and infusing your unique style into your products, you can enhance your brand's appeal and recognition.

Boosting Visibility with Marketing Strategies

Having a great product is just the first step; successful marketing strategies are essential to increase your visibility. Optimizing product listings with relevant keywords enhances your searchability on the platform. Additionally, leveraging social media and email marketing allows you to engage with your audience directly, cultivating a loyal customer base and driving sales. Collaborating with influencers or participating in relevant online communities can further translate to increased brand awareness.

Fostering Quality and Customer Service

Quality matters in the print-on-demand business. A commitment to high standards in production and outstanding customer service can significantly elevate your brand reputation. Satisfied customers are more likely to return and recommend your products to others, creating a cycle of trust and loyalty that is invaluable for a growing business. Aim to continuously improve your offerings based on feedback and market demand.

Conclusion: Your Journey Starts Here

Amazon Merch undoubtedly serves as an accessible launchpad for aspiring entrepreneurs looking to monetize their creativity. With the right approach to design, marketing, and customer engagement, you have the potential to build a successful e-commerce venture. Elevate Your Leaders: Key Components of Leadership Development Training

Update Building Strong Leaders: The Essentials of Leadership Development Training In the fast-paced world of business, the ability to lead effectively is invaluable. Leadership development training is not just a formality; it’s a necessity for nurturing top talent. By understanding five essential components of an effective leadership curriculum, individuals and organizations can ensure that their leaders are well-equipped for the challenges of tomorrow. Self-Assessment: The Starting Point for Growth Before venturing into leadership training, the first crucial step is self-assessment. This phase allows leaders to identify their unique strengths and areas for improvement. Tools such as feedback from colleagues and personal reflection help in evaluating leadership styles and effectiveness. Leadership training, particularly for managers, is tailored more effectively when you start from a place of understanding your current landscape. For instance, assessing how your communication style aligns with your organization’s culture can offer a roadmap for development. Setting SMART Goals: A Blueprint for Success Following self-assessment, the next component is setting clear objectives. Utilizing the SMART framework—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ound—is essential. This ensures that goals not only reflect personal growth trajectories but also align with the organization’s mission and strategic direction. By continually revisiting these goals, leaders can adapt to changing needs within their industry and foster a culture of growth. Diverse Development Methods: Catering to Different Learning Styles The ancient proverb "there's more than one way to skin a cat" rings especially true when it comes to leadership development methods. From instructor-led training—which remains popular for structured learning—to professional coaching that offers personalized guidance, leaders have a wealth of options to cater to different learning styles. Expand your toolbox to include mentoring and online courses, ensuring that every leader finds a method that resonates with their personal learning preferences and enhances their skill set. Measuring Progress: Ensuring Accountability in Leadership Development No training program is effective without a mechanism for measuring success. Regular analysis of training outcomes allows organizations to assess effectiveness and make necessary adjustments. Regular feedback loops and performance metrics not only track individual progress but also enhance the training curriculum to ensure it remains relevant and impactful. Embracing Continuous Growth: The Key to Sustainable Leadership Leadership does not stop at skill acquisition; rather, it evolves. Taking a long-term approach to leadership development means ensuring that continuous growth is woven into the fabric of corporate culture. From adapting to new leadership trends to fostering an environment that encourages lifelong learning, organizations can nurture a robust talent pipeline that proactively prepares leaders for future challenges. In conclusion, each of these components—self-assessment, goal setting, diverse methods, measuring progress, and continuous growth—works together to create a solid foundation for effective leadership development. Investing in a robust leadership training program not only empowers individuals but can fundamentally transform organizational culture. As leaders continue to develop their skills, they cultivate environments where future leaders can thrive.

Why Understanding the Rebranding Process is Key for Business Success

Update The Rebranding Process: Why It Matters In a world where consumer preferences shift as quickly as trends emerge, rebranding serves as a critical lifeline for many companies. It’s not just about updating logos or colors; it involves a deep examination and revitalization of a company's identity. This process acts as a strategic necessity, empowering businesses to navigate the turbulent waters of market changes while maintaining relevance. The core of rebranding lies in aligning your business identity with the evolving landscape of consumer expectations and market trends. The Steps Involved: From Research to Execution Successful rebranding begins with thorough market research aimed at identifying target audiences and assessing current perceptions. This groundwork is crucial to redefine a brand’s message and create a unified visual identity. Once a new strategy is set in motion, engaging stakeholders, particularly employees, ensures that the new identity resonates internally and aligns with the organization’s values. Additionally, post-launch evaluation is paramount; companies must continuously monitor consumer sentiment to ensure that their changes foster loyalty and profitability. The Risks of Rebranding: Navigating Common Pitfalls While rebranding can revitalize a business, it’s fraught with potential pitfalls that can derail even the best-laid plans. One of the major challenges is the risk of alienating existing customers who may deeply associate with the previous brand identity. Careful communication is essential to mitigate such risks, ensuring that both existing and new customers feel engaged and valued throughout the transition. Another common misstep is underestimating the internal process of aligning employees with the new brand vision, which can lead to mixed messaging and diluted efforts. Case Studies: Learning from Success and Failure Examining successful rebranding examples highlights its potential benefits. For instance, CVS’s overhaul of its loyalty program not only refreshed its image but significantly boosted membership growth and customer engagement. Conversely, companies like Gap have faced backlash due to abrupt logo changes that strayed too far from their established identities, emphasizing the importance of thoughtful execution in rebranding processes. Conclusion: The Need for a Flexible Brand Strategy In conclusion, rebranding is not merely a cosmetic change; it's a comprehensive strategy that allows companies to remain competitive in ever-evolving markets. As businesses face challenges, like crises or mergers, a cohesive identity can aid in rebuilding trust and enhancing customer connection. To thrive in today's dynamic environment, brands must not only adapt but also anticipate shifts in consumer behavior to remain relevant.

The Secret to Mastering Cold Email Outreach: Proven Strategies for Success

Update Mastering Cold Email Outreach: Strategies for Success In today’s digital landscape, excelling in cold email outreach demands a recipe of strategic planning, insight, and creativity. It’s not just about sending messages; it’s about building connections that can transform your outreach into successful partnerships. Understanding your audience is the key first step toward crafting emails that resonate. Understanding Your Target Audience is Critical The foundation of effective cold email outreach lies in knowing who you’re reaching out to. Analyze your target demographics, focus on their unique challenges, and tailor your messaging accordingly. This fundamental understanding allows you to create personalized messages that speak directly to recipients' pain points—a tactic that can significantly improve engagement rates. The Art of Crafting Compelling Emails Once you’re clear on who your audience is, it’s time to craft your cold emails. Start with a friendly, personalized introduction, spotlight relevant challenges they face, and clearly define the value proposition you offer. Remember, the subject line is your first impression—make it catchy yet relevant to encourage opens. Research indicates that effective cold emails can achieve response rates up to 50% higher when they are personalized. A clear call-to-action (CTA) guides the recipient to the next step, whether that’s scheduling a meeting or exploring your service offering. Utilizing Follow-Up Strategies for Enhanced Engagement Following up is an often-overlooked cornerstone of successful cold emailing. Statistics show that follow-ups can account for approximately 70% of meetings generated via email. Space your follow-ups strategically, anywhere from 3 to 7 days apart, to remain top-of-mind without becoming intrusive. The Power of A/B Testing Continuous improvement is vital in cold email outreach. Employ A/B testing not just for subject lines, but also for email content and CTAs. This iterative approach refines your strategies, enhancing engagement, and improving the chances of conversion. Leverage the Right Tools for Maximum Impact To streamline your outreach, consider using automation tools like Mailshake or CRM platforms that include Google Analytics for performance tracking. These tools help analyze engagement metrics, facilitating data-driven decisions for future campaigns. Conclusion: Transform Your Cold Outreach Cold email outreach isn’t just a numbers game; it’s about creating meaningful engagements that could lead to productive business relationships. By mastering the craft of cold emailing through personalization, follow-ups, and effective use of tools, you elevate your outreach strategy significantly.
